  • Description

    Drive’s white powder coated steel assistive bed M-Rail provides support when getting into and out of bed. It also gives added independence to someone who may need help to sit up, reposition, stand, or transfer out of bed to a mobile device like a walker or wheelchair. Its compact and ergonomically contoured M shape handle with a padded, no-slip grip allows for various hand positions to accommodate any user. Multiple crossbars creates easy grip for any height use. The special extra-long nylon safety straps wrap around the mattress or box spring to ensure a secure fit. It fits bed widths from single to king size. Also, included is a black accessory pouch with pockets that can hold personal items such as, glasses, television remote, magazines and much more. Assembly is quick and tool-free making this perfect for any home or for travel.

     

    Features & Benefits

      • Designed to provide support when getting into and out of bed and when moving from a lying position to a sitting position
      • M shape allows for multiple hand positions to accommodate any user
      • Multiple crossbars creates easy grip for any height use
      • Easy, quick assembly
      • Safety strap wraps around mattress or box spring to ensure a secure fit
      • Special extra-long safety strap enables user to be in a single, twin, double, queen or king size bed
      • Made of powder coated steel for long life and easy cleaning
      • Includes accessory pouch for storing remote controls, glasses, magazines and more

     

  • Specs
    • Product Weight Capacity: 300 lbs
    • Warranty: Limited Lifetime
